English: A E Smith and Son, Funeral Directors, Queens Drive, Swindon Although the postal address of this long-established firm is as in the title, the actual entrance is from Dudmore Road, visible in the foreground. The firm began operating in Swindon in the 1880s nearer the centre of the town and moved to this location in the 1960s. |
